An Open-Label Randomized Phase III Study of Intermittent Oral Capecitabine in Combination with Intravenous Oxaliplatin (Q3W) (“XELOX”) versus Bolus and Continuous Infusion Fluorouracil/Intravenous Leucovorin with Intravenous Oxaliplatin (Q2W) (“FOLFOX4”) as Treatment for Patients with Metastatic Colorectal Cancer who have Received Prior Treatment with CPT- 11 in Combination with 5-FU/LV as First Line Therapy.

Exclusion criteria

Exclusion criteria: *) Received more than one prior chemotherapeutic or other systemic anti-cancer treatment regimen in the metastatic setting. *) Prior active or passive immunotherapy for metastatic disease, unless in combination with first line CPT-11 + 5-FU/LV. *) Prior treatment with oxaliplatin. *) Pregnant or lactating women. *) Women of childbearing potential with either a positive or no pregnancy test at baseline. Postmenopausal women must have been amenorrheic for at least 12 months to be considered of non-childbearing potential. *) Sexually active males and females (of childbearing potential) unwilling to practice contraception during the study. *) History of another malignancy within the last five years except cured basal cell carcinoma of skin and cured carcinoma in-situ of uterine cervix. *) History or evidence upon physical examination of CNS disease (e.g., primary brain tumor, seizure not controlled with standard medical therapy, any brain metastases, or history of stroke). *) History of psychiatric disability judged by the investigator to be clinically significant, precluding informed consent or interfering with compliance for oral drug intake. *) Clinically significant (i.e. active) cardiovascular disease e.g. uncontrolled hypertension, unstable angina, New York Heart Association (NYHA) grade II or greater congestive heart failure, serious cardiac arrhythmia requiring medication, or grade II or greater peripheral vascular. In addition patients with myocardial infarction within 1 year prior to study treatment start will be excluded (see appendix 10). *) Lack of physical integrity of the upper gastrointestinal tract, malabsorption syndrome, or inability to take oral medication. *) Interstitial pneumonia or extensive symptomatic fibrosis of the lungs. *) Known peripheral neuropathy ? NCI CTC grade 1. Absence of deep tendon reflexes (DTRs) as the sole neurologic abnormality does not render the patient ineligible. *) Organ allografts requiring immunosuppressive therapy. *) Serious uncontrolled intercurrent infections, or other serious uncontrolled concomitant disease. *) Moderate or severe renal impairment [creatinine clearance equal to or below 50 mL/min (calculated according to Cockroft and Gault, Appendix 3)], or serum creatinine > 1.5 x upper limit of normal (ULN). *) Any of the following laboratory values: • Absolute neutrophil count (ANC) 1.5 x ULN • ALAT, ASAT > 2.5 x ULN, or > 5 x (ULN) in case of liver metastases *) Alkaline phosphatase > 2.5 x ULN, or > 5 x ULN in case of liver metastases, or > 10 x ULN in case of bone metastases. *) Prior unanticipated severe reaction to fluoropyrimidine therapy, or known dihydropyrimidine dehydrogenase (DPD) deficiency. *) Known hypersensitivity to platinum compounds or any of the components of the study medications. *) Major surgery within 4 weeks prior to study treatment start, or lack of complete recovery from the effects of major surgery.

Design outcomes

Primary

MeasureTime frame
Main Objective: To demonstrate that the combination of capecitabine plus oxaliplatin ("XELOX") is at least equivalent to the combination of 5-fluorouracil plus leucovorin plus oxaliplatin ("FOLFOX-4”) in terms of time to tumor progression or death (TTP) in patients with metastatic colorectal carcinoma who have received prior treatment with CPT-11 in combination with 5-FU as first line therapy.;Secondary Objective: • To evaluate and compare the efficacy (overall survival, overall response rate according to the RECIST criteria, time to response, duration of response, and time to treatment failure) in the two treatment groups. • To evaluate and compare the safety profiles of the treatment groups using the NCI CTCAE (version 3.0). • To evaluate and compare perceived treatment convenience and satisfaction with treatment for patients in the two treatment groups. • To evaluate and compare medical care utilization in the two treatment groups. • To offer patients participating in the study the possibility to also participate in the independent sub-study NO16967RG designed to derive pharmacogenetic information to facilitate research regarding prediction of response to specific drug therapy, susceptibility to develop adverse effects or progress to more severe disease, or identify genetic risk factors for disease. ;Primary end point(s): At least equivalence with respect time to tumor progression or death (TTP).
